Analysis
Wanting to further strengthen their security alliance: Donald Trump and Sanae Takaichi display the signed documents. (October 28, 2025). Photo: Heute.at/ CC BY 4.0 https://creativecommons.org/licenses/by/4.0/
08 Feb 2026
Japan election: from stagnation to stagflation